All rumors suggest that Apple will officially present its first mixed reality glasses in early 2023 at a special event to prevent its new product from being overshadowed by the Cupertino-based company’s other launches.

Now, through Digitimes, we have been able to learn that the roadmap set by Apple is perfectly fulfilled, so the next Reality glasses will reach the market at the agreed time.

Mass production of Apple glasses will begin in March 2023

Note that in the case of this product, you probably Apple is giving a January presentation first but it will definitely go on sale at the end of the year.

That’s why the prestigious media outlet and the company’s Pegatron will be responsible for mass production of mixed reality glasses.The company founded by Steve Jobs and this production will start in March 2023.

It’s also crucial to note that the initial production of Apple’s mixed reality glasses will be quite limited, as their high price will mean few users will be willing to pay. The cost of this gadget is between 3,000 and 5,000 euros.

According to the calculations madeApple is expected to ship a total of about one million units of these augmented and virtual reality glasses.. Additionally, such a limited order makes the production price more expensive, another reason to know that Apple’s glasses aren’t exactly going to be cheap.

As for the features that these mixed reality glasses will have, there is currently no official information from the company. It is expected to feature MiniLED lenses to offer excellent image quality as well as being a fully autonomous device, with no wires blocking the experience between them.
